What to Consider When Choosing a Robot Vacuum:
Choosing the ideal robot vacuum involves more than just selecting the flashiest design. Thoroughly think about the following aspects to guarantee you select a device that genuinely meets your requirements and offers worth:
Budget: Robot vacuums range in price from under ₤ 200 to over ₤ 1000. Determine your budget upfront to limit your alternatives. Keep in mind that greater cost points often associate with more sophisticated functions like smarter navigation, stronger suction, and self-emptying abilities.Floor Types: Consider the dominant floor key ins your home. Houses with mainly tough floors might take advantage of models with mopping functions, while homes with thick carpets need strong suction power and brush roll designs engineered for carpet cleaning. Some models are flexible and carry out well on both hard floors and carpets.Pet Ownership: Pet hair is a typical cleaning challenge. If you have family pets, try to find robot vacuums specifically designed to take on pet hair. These typically feature tangle-free brush rolls, robust suction, and efficient filtration systems to catch allergens.Home Size and Layout: Larger homes or those with several levels may require robot vacuums with longer battery life and smart mapping functions to guarantee complete cleaning coverage. Residences with complicated layouts and various barriers will gain from advanced navigation systems.Smart Features and Connectivity: Do you want app control, scheduling, virtual walls, or voice assistant combination? Smart includes boost benefit and customisation however often come at a greater price.Navigation and Mapping:Random Bounce: Basic designs often utilize random bounce navigation, which is less effective but can still clean up efficiently in smaller areas.Systematic Navigation (LiDAR or Camera-based): More sophisticated designs utilize L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) or camera-based systems to map your home and navigate methodically. This results in more efficient cleaning, room-by-room cleaning, and the capability to set virtual borders.Suction Power: Measured in Pascals (Pa), suction power determines how efficiently a robot vacuum selects up dirt and debris. Greater suction is typically better, particularly for carpets and pet hair.Battery Life and Charging: Battery life dictates for how long the robot vacuum can operate on a single charge. Consider the size of your home and select a design with adequate battery life to clean it efficiently. Automatic recharging is a standard function, where the robot go back to its dock when the battery is low.Self-Emptying Feature: Some premium models come with self-emptying bases. These bases instantly suck the dust and debris from the robot's dustbin into a bigger, non reusable bag, substantially minimizing the frequency of manual dustbin clearing and boosting convenience.Sound Level: Robot vacuums vary in sound output. If noise level of sensitivity is a concern, try to find designs promoted as quiet operating.
Leading Robot Vacuum Recommendations in the UK:
Based on efficiency, functions, and value in the UK market, here are some extremely recommended robot vacuums throughout various classifications:
1. Best Overall Robot Vacuum: iRobot Roomba j7+
Key Features: Imprint Smart Mapping, PrecisionVision Navigation (object avoidance), self-emptying Clean Base, customised cleaning suggestions, app control, voice assistant combination.Benefits: The iRobot Roomba j7+ stands out in its smart navigation and object acknowledgment, with confidence preventing pet waste, cable televisions, and other typical household obstacles. The self-emptying base includes supreme convenience, and the smart mapping permits for targeted space cleaning and virtual limits. Its powerful cleaning performance on both tough floors and carpets makes it a top all-rounder.Pros: Exceptional object avoidance, reliable cleaning, hassle-free self-emptying base, smart mapping and app control.Cons: Premium rate point, self-emptying bags need to be replaced periodically.Suitable for: Homes of any size, particularly those with pets and hectic homes who prioritize benefit and smart cleaning.
2. Best Robot Vacuum for Pet Hair: Shark IQ Robot Self-Empty XL R101AE
Secret Features: Self-emptying base, XL dust bin capacity, effective suction, pet hair cleaning brush roll, row-by-row cleaning, app control, voice control.Advantages: Designed specifically for homes with family pets, the Shark IQ Robot excels at dealing with pet hair and dander. The self-emptying base and extra-large dustbin are especially beneficial for pet owners. The powerful suction and self-cleaning brush roll effectively eliminate pet hair from carpets and hard floorings.Pros: Excellent pet hair cleaning, large self-emptying bin, powerful suction, more inexpensive than some premium rivals.Cons: Navigation can be less refined than LiDAR-based models, may fight with very intricate layouts.Perfect for: Pet owners looking for a trustworthy and effective robot vacuum for managing pet hair at a more available cost point.
3. Best Budget-Friendly Robot Vacuum: Eufy RoboVac 15C Max
Secret Features: BoostIQ Technology (Automatic cleaning robot suction change), slim style, strong suction (2000Pa), Wi-Fi connectivity, app and voice control, peaceful operation.Advantages: The Eufy RoboVac 15C Max offers outstanding cleaning performance at an economical price. Its slim profile allows it to navigate under furnishings quickly, and the BoostIQ innovation immediately increases suction when needed. Wi-Fi connectivity adds smart features without breaking the bank.Pros: Affordable, strong suction for its rate variety, slim design, app and voice control.Cons: Basic navigation (random bounce), no mapping or self-emptying features, smaller sized dustbin.Perfect for: Those on a budget plan looking for a reliable robot vacuum for smaller homes or apartment or condos, or for extra cleaning.
4. Best Robot Vacuum for Hard Floors and Mopping: Roborock S7 MaxV Ultra
Key Features: LiDAR Navigation, ReactiveAI 2.0 Obstacle Avoidance, VibraRise Mopping (sonic vibration), self-emptying, self-washing, and self-refilling dock, app control, voice control, carpet detection.Advantages: The Roborock S7 MaxV Ultra is a premium all-in-one cleaning service. Its sophisticated LiDAR navigation and item avoidance, combined with its powerful vacuuming and sonic mopping abilities, make it incredibly flexible. The all-in-one dock automates dustbin emptying, mop washing, and water refilling, using unrivaled benefit, particularly for homes with a mix of hard floorings and carpets.Pros: Exceptional navigation and obstacle avoidance, outstanding mopping performance, practical all-in-one dock, effective vacuuming.Cons: High price point, complex setup, dock requires significant area.Ideal for: Homes with a variety of floor types, those looking for top-tier cleaning efficiency and supreme convenience, and those happy to purchase premium features.
5. Best Robot Vacuum for Smart Home Integration: Ecovacs Deebot X1 Omni
Secret Features: AIVI 3D Obstacle Avoidance, LiDAR Navigation, OZMO Turbo 2.0 Rotating Mopping, self-emptying, self-washing, and hot air drying dock, integrated voice assistant (YIKO), video manager with two-way communication.Advantages: The Ecovacs Deebot X1 Omni is a feature-rich robot vacuum that incorporates seamlessly into smart homes. Its innovative challenge avoidance, effective vacuuming, rotating mopping, and comprehensive self-cleaning dock deliver a premium cleaning experience. The integrated voice assistant and video supervisor even more boost its smart abilities.Pros: Exceptional barrier avoidance, reliable mopping and vacuuming, detailed self-cleaning dock with hot air drying, incorporated voice assistant and video features.Cons: Very pricey, complex functions might be overwhelming for some users, larger dock footprint.Ideal for: Tech-savvy users with smart homes who want the most innovative features, top-tier cleaning efficiency, and seamless integration.
Tips for Getting one of the most Out of Your Robot Vacuum:
To guarantee your robot vacuum operates efficiently and efficiently for many years to come, think about these handy suggestions:
Prepare Your Home: Before running your robot vacuum, declutter your floorings by eliminating loose cable televisions, small toys, and other challenges that could prevent its navigation or get tangled in the brushes.Regular Maintenance: Empty the dustbin frequently (or less frequently with self-emptying designs), tidy the brushes and filters as recommended by the producer, and examine for any obstructions or use and tear.Set Up Cleaning Sessions: Utilize the scheduling feature to set your robot vacuum to clean automatically at convenient times, such as when you are at work or asleep.Usage Virtual Boundaries: If your robot vacuum has virtual wall or zoned cleaning functions, utilize them to avoid the robot from going into particular locations or to target cleaning to particular spaces.Screen Performance: Occasionally observe your robot vacuum in action to guarantee it is cleaning efficiently and browsing properly. Address any issues quickly.Keep Software Updated: If your robot vacuum has app connection, ensure you keep the firmware and app updated to benefit from the current features and performance enhancements.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s):
Q: Are robot vacuums worth the financial investment?A: For busy individuals and those looking for to minimize their cleaning workload, robot vacuums can be a beneficial financial investment. They automate a tedious chore and can maintain a regularly cleaner home.Q: Can robot vacuums replace conventional vacuums completely?A: Robot vacuums are exceptional for regular upkeep cleaning but may not entirely change traditional vacuums for deep cleaning tasks, corner cleaning, or cleaning upholstery and stairs. Many users find they supplement their robot vacuum with a traditional vacuum for more extensive cleaning.Q: How typically should I run my robot vacuum?A: Daily cleaning is perfect for keeping a consistently tidy home, specifically in homes with family pets or children. However, you can change the frequency based upon your requirements and family traffic.Q: Do robot vacuums deal with carpets and rugs?A: Yes, many robot vacuums are created to deal with both difficult floorings and carpets. Look for models with strong suction and brush rolls developed for carpet cleaning performance.Q: How long do robot vacuums generally last?A: With correct maintenance, an excellent quality robot vacuum can last for numerous years, normally 3-5 years or longer depending upon usage and brand name.Q: Are robot vacuums noisy?A: Robot vacuums typically produce less noise than conventional vacuums, but sound levels vary in between designs. Some designs are specifically designed for quieter operation.Q: What is the distinction between LiDAR and camera-based navigation?A: L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) uses lasers to create a detailed map of your home, providing exact navigation and effective cleaning paths. Camera-based systems utilize visual information to navigate. LiDAR is normally thought about more accurate and effective in low-light conditions.
